Núria de Gispert
Núria de Gispert i Català is a Spanish politician and lawyer. Between 2010 and 2015 she served as speaker of Parliament of Catalonia.
Biography
Núria de Gispert is married and has four children. She is also the daughter of politician and lawyer Ignasi de Gispert i Jordà, and great-granddaughter of Dorotea de Chopitea, protector and benefactor of several Catholic orders. De Gispert graduated in law at the University of Barcelona and she has also the title of legal translator from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Cooperation of Spain. She worked as lawyer from1971 to 1973. She started to work as civil servant at the Diputació de Barcelona in 1974; later, in 1980, she was moved to the Generalitat.
In recognition of her task as lawyer, he was awarded the Cross of St. Raymond of Peñafort, the Cross of Merit to the Service of the Spanish Advocacy and the Medal of the Bar Association of Barcelona. She is also a member of the Academy of Jurisprudence and Legislation of Catalonia since 2006.
